NAMEIF(8) Linux's Administrator's Manual NAMEIF(8)NAMEnameif - name network interfaces based on MAC addresses
SYNOPSISnameif [-c configfile] [-s]
nameif [-c configfile] [-s] [interface macaddress]
nameif [-c configfile] [-r] [newifname oldifname]
DESCRIPTIONnameif renames network interfaces based on mac addresses or interface
names. When no arguments are given /etc/mactab is read. Each line of
it contains an interface name and a Ethernet MAC address. Comments are
allowed starting with #. Otherwise the interfaces specified on the
command line are processed. nameif looks for the interface with the
given MAC address or old interface name and renames it to the name
given.
OPTIONS
[-s|--syslog]
Log all error messages to syslog.
[-r|--rename]
Rename the interface given by oldifname to the new name newifâ
name without consulting any macaddress.
[-c|--config-file configfile]
Read configfile instead of /etc/mactab.
NOTESnameif should be run before the interface is up, otherwise it'll fail.
FILES
/etc/mactab
BUGS
Only works for Ethernet currently.
